Abstract

The utility model discloses a waste gas column bag recovery device which comprises an upper frame, wherein a motor is fixedly connected to the outer surface of one side of the upper frame, a lower frame is fixedly connected to the outer surface of the lower end of the upper frame, a feeding port mechanism is fixedly connected to the outer surface of one side of the upper frame, a discharging port is formed in the outer surface of one side of the lower frame, a receiving box mechanism is movably connected to the inner wall of the discharging port, fine impurities or larger uncrushed raw products can be screened out through the use of a screen, secondary stirring can be better carried out, the feeding port mechanism can fix a dust blocking cover on a feeding hopper by utilizing a chute no matter when a machine works or stops, a fixed plate and a baffle plate are arranged on the chute, the raw products are not easy to fall off, the dust blocking cover can be slid in the machine during working, the pollutant is prevented from entering, the dust blocking cover can also be slid during stopping, convenience is brought to workers, the service life of the machine is prolonged, and the working efficiency is improved.

Background
The air column bag is also called buffer air column bag and inflatable bag, and is a new-type packaging system using natural air for filling, and the air column type buffer shock-proof protection of comprehensive cladding can reduce the product transportation loss rate to minimum.

Principle of operation
The air column bag recycling device can put the waste original product air column bag into the hopper 601, the second chute 607 is sleeved in the first chute 603, the dust blocking cover 605 is prevented from falling off due to the fact that the fixing plate 604 and the pinch plate 608 are buckled with each other, the dust blocking cover 605 is prevented from falling off after being inserted into the chute, the baffle 602 plays a fixed role, the dust blocking cover 605 is prevented from falling down, the dust blocking cover is further fixed, the original product can become particles after being stirred in a machine, the waste original product falls into the receiving box 502 from the discharge hole 4, fine impurities or larger non-crushed original products can be screened out due to the use of the screen 507 arranged in the receiving box 502, secondary crushing can be performed better, so that recycling is performed, and the stability of the receiving box 502 can be improved due to the fact that the receiving box 502 is drawn and can twist through the receiving box 502 and is clamped in the fixing bayonet 511.
